Foundation and Identification:

The Conservatory of Maltepe University was established as “the Department of Music” in the fall semester of 2018. The Department of Music comprises the programmes: String Instruments (Violin, Viola and Violoncello) / Piano-Harp-Guitar / Composition and Orchestral Conducting / Wind and Percussion Instruments at the privileged campus of Maltepe University, The Conservatory has brought the Children’s Music Conservatory and the Part-time Certificate Training Program into practice.

Vision:

In the following academic year, the first target of the Conservatory is to establish the Musicology-Ethnomusicology department. Besides, bringing the Department of Turkish Music into practice with the expanding physical conditions of our new conservatory building.
